Photo of Mr Charles Doughty Mr Charles Doughty , East Surrey 12:00, 4 November 1960

I could not follow the hon. Gentleman on one point. Probably it was my fault. He said that before the N.A.T.O. Powers used any retaliatory efforts, nuclear or otherwise, there should be full consultation. If there were an all-out devastating attack on one of the Powers, does he suggest that none of the other Powers should retaliate without full consultation with the remaining fifteen Powers?
